QNAP D4 (Rev. B)
On November 23, 2021 Russian , the office QNAP presented a localized four-disc D4 networked storage (Rev. B), who in comparison with the previous D4 model received more productive quad-core processor Annapurna Labs Alpine AL‑214 with a frequency of 1.7 GHz and 2 GB. RAM The equipment includes two gigabit network RJ45 ports, as well as two Gen 1 ports USB 3.2 for connecting external devices, such as drives, expansion modules, and, adapters Wi‑Fi and Bluetooth UPS sound cards.
The NAS can have four 2.5 or 3.5 inch HDDs or SSDs with a 6 Gb/s SATA interface. When using 18 TB HDD, storage capacity can reach 72 TB, and when connecting USB expansion modules - 216 TB (in the case of two TR-004 or one TL-D800C).

QNAP D-2 (Rev. B)
The Russian QNAP office on August 17, 2021 introduced the localized network drive D2 (Rev. B) in a compact desktop chassis with two disk bays, which is designed for home use and solutions such as reliable and centralized file storage, backup and synchronization, creation of a media library and a secure personal cloud.
Hardware basis D2 (Rev. B) quad-core processor Realtek RTD1296 1,4 GHz and random access memory of DDR4 with a capacity of 2 GB make 64bitny. To connect to the network, there is a gigabit port RJ-45, and for peripherals such as external disks, adapters Wi‑Fi and, Bluetooth sound cards, printers and, UPS two ports 3.2 USB Gen 1 and one USB 2.0 port.

Additional software such as smart home appliances, home network management and monitoring can be installed on D2 (Rev. B) via Container Station with support for LXC and Docker technologies.
Power consumption D2 (Rev. B) in normal operating mode is 13 W (with two installed disks of 2 TB), and in sleep state - only 5 W. The intelligent active cooling system uses a quiet fan with a diameter of 80 mm - the noise level in the operation is 15 dB.
